When it concerns preserving the security and performance of your home's power supply, hiring a Hills District Level 2 Electrician is a necessary action for any significant job or emergency situation. While basic electricians are perfectly capable of handling internal tasks like installing light switches or power points, a Hills District Level 2 Electrician holds sophisticated accreditation that permits them to work straight on the electrical energy distribution network. This level of Hills District Level 2 Electrician expertise is critical in an area that combines recognized heritage homes with rapidly developing domestic estates. These specialised professionals function as the main link in between the street's power lines and your personal electrical board, handling high-risk jobs that basic electricians are not lawfully permitted to carry out. By choosing a certified Hills District Level 2 Electrician, property owners guarantee they are abiding by strict NSW security policies and the specific requirements of network suppliers like Endeavour Energy.
Among the most frequent reasons locals seek out a Hills District Level 2 Electrician is for the installation and upkeep of overhead and underground service lines. In lots of leafy parts of the Hills District, power is still provided by means of overhead cable televisions that can be vulnerable to storm damage and falling branches. A Hills District Level 2 Electrician is equipped with the heavy-duty tools and cherry pickers required to repair these aerial lines or replace outdated point-of-attachment brackets. Conversely, for new builds or visual renovations, a Hills District Level 2 Electrician is frequently tasked with installing underground consumer mains. This involves accurate trenching and the laying of high-capacity cabling to ensure a streamlined, trusted power supply that is protected from the aspects. Whether you need a personal power pole set up or wish to move your service lines underground, the technical ability of a Hills District Level 2 Electrician is indispensable for a safe connection.
The authority of a Hills District Level 2 Electrician also extends to complicated metering and switchboard upgrades. As more households in the region embrace sustainable innovation, the need for a Hills District Level 2 Electrician to set up solar-compatible wise meters and high-capacity three-phase power systems has actually grown significantly. Modern homes typically run multiple high-drain home appliances at the same time, from ducted air conditioning to electrical vehicle battery chargers, which can overwhelm older single-phase systems. A Hills District Level 2 Electrician can examine your present load and update your connection to ensure your home handles these contemporary needs without constant circuit tripping or safety dangers. Additionally, if you get a problem notification from your energy supplier due to a risky meter box or faulty electrical wiring, just a recognized Hills District Level 2 Electrician can legally correct the issue and send the compliance documentation needed to clear the notification and keep your power running.
Emergency situations are another location where the abilities of a Hills District Level 2 Electrician are paramount. Because they are authorised to carry out "live work," a Hills District Level 2 Electrician can securely isolate and reconnect power at the network limit without waiting for an utility team to show up. This ability is important during extreme weather events when fallen power lines or burnt-out service fuses leave households without electrical power. A Hills District Level 2 Electrician can respond quickly to these risks, carrying out immediate repairs to restore power and make sure the site is safe for the general public.
